Answer : The correct answer is A ( N acetyl - muramic acid)
Exaplanation : N-acetyl glucoseamine and the N-acetyl muramic are the alteranating units found in the Peptidoglycan (murein), is a component of eubacterial cell walls that forms the mesh like structure around the cellwhich are linked by beta 1-4 Glycosidic Bond.
